One of the elemental elements of comparing vintages is understanding the importance of terroir, the unique environmental conditions of a selected vineyard website. Terroir encompasses soil composition, climate, and the micro-ecosystem that collectively form the characteristics of the grapes grown there. Vintages from the identical property can differ significantly when climate patterns fluctuate from year to yr, illustrating how terroir interacts with local weather to supply distinctive wines.
When tasting varied vintages, one often notices the evolution of fruit flavors and supporting buildings like acidity and tannins. A younger wine may showcase recent, vibrant fruit traits that can fade with age, whereas older vintages would possibly reveal more complexity, including tertiary aromas and flavors like leather-based, tobacco, or dried fruits. These changes occur as a outcome of gradual chemical reactions that develop over time, offering an interesting realm for exploration throughout tastings.

A vintage refers back to the yr during which the grapes were harvested to supply a selected wine. Every vintage can exhibit totally different traits primarily based on weather circumstances, grape high quality, and winemaking techniques throughout that year - Vineyard Tours in Sonoma : Plan Your Visit.

How does climate affect wine vintages?
Weather performs an important position in the rising season, influencing grape ripeness, flavor improvement, and general quality. A notably sizzling or wet 12 months can lead to vital variations within the wine produced, making some vintages standout in comparability with others.
